India Paint Prices Threaten Home Upgrade Costs

Paint manufacturers in India may raise prices by 2 to 5 per cent if crude oil costs remain elevated, a development that could increase home renovation expenses and maintenance budgets across cities. The possible move matters for households, landlords and builders because paint is closely linked to housing turnover, commercial interiors and urban upkeep.

Industry estimates indicate producers are monitoring raw material inflation before making final pricing decisions. Many paint ingredients, including solvents, resins and packaging inputs, are derived directly or indirectly from petroleum, making the sector sensitive to movements in global crude markets. If costs stay high for an extended period, companies may begin phased increases rather than sharp one-time revisions. Major players such as Asian Paints, Berger Paints India, Kansai Nerolac and Birla Opus Paints operate in a market where pricing power is balanced against intense competition. That means manufacturers often delay increases until they are confident demand can absorb higher rates without significant volume loss.For urban consumers, even modest price revisions can have a visible impact. Repainting apartments, societies, offices and retail units is typically planned around seasonal weather windows or possession cycles. A 2 to 5 per cent increase may appear limited, but for large housing societies or commercial properties it can materially raise annual maintenance budgets.The wider property market could also feel secondary effects. Developers completing mid-income housing projects often face tight cost calculations, where finishes such as paint, flooring and fittings are budget-sensitive.

If multiple input categories rise simultaneously, final handover costs may increase or developers may seek lower-cost alternatives.Analysts note that demand in the sector remains steady, with entry-level emulsions and economy products growing faster than premium categories in several regions. This suggests price-conscious consumers are already adjusting spending behaviour. If paint prices rise further, value brands and smaller pack sizes could see stronger demand. There is also a sustainability angle. Longer-lasting coatings, heat-reflective exterior paints and low-emission indoor products can reduce repainting frequency and improve building efficiency. However, greener formulations often carry higher upfront costs, making affordability crucial if cities want wider adoption of climate-resilient materials.Manufacturers therefore face a dual challenge: protecting margins while keeping products accessible to households and contractors. In a country adding millions of urban residents over the coming decade, coatings are not just consumer goods—they are part of housing quality, energy performance and city maintenance.

The next few months will depend largely on crude oil trends. If prices soften, companies may avoid broad hikes. If they remain high, gradual increases are likely, placing greater focus on durability, value and lifecycle costs for consumers planning upgrades in 2026.
